Date of Birth
Only those candidates whose date of birth falls on or after 01 October 1991 are eligible. Date of birth as recorded in the 10th or 12th standard certificate, as issued by the Board/University only, will be taken as authentic. Candidates must produce this certificate in original as proof of their age at the time of counselling.
Selection Criteria
Admission to the above programs will be based on the All India Rank of Joint Entrance Examination 2016 (JEE-2016) Main, which is conducted by CBSE. Therefore, candidates who are appearing for JEE 2016 Main can only apply for these programs.
The short-listed candidates, will be offered admission (confirmed/ waitlisted) in order of their merit (based on the All India Ranking of JEE 2016).

FINANCIAL SUPPORT
The Institute provides financial support in the form of scholarships to eligible students as per details given below.
DA-IICT Scholarships
A few students admitted to the programs would be awarded merit scholarships equivalent to full tuition fees. The Institute shall draw a list of students eligible for merit scholarship based on the admission ranks drawn from Gujarat and All India Categories separately. In addition, five merit-cum-means scholarships would be offered to the students with highest ranks subject to a means test.
Reliance Scholarships
The Reliance, as part of its Corporate Social Responsibilities (CSR), has instituted ten merit-cum-means scholarships from 2014 and 2015 batch and the plan is to extend the scholarships to 2016 batch. The scholarship is equal to the full tuition fee for the duration in which the scholarship is awarded.
Mukhya Mantri Yuva Swavalamban Yojna, Government of Gujarat The admitted B.Tech students are encouraged to apply for the ‘Chief Minister Scholarship Scheme’ of the Government of Gujarat. The Scheme provides financial support to bright and needy students whose parents yearly income is up to Rs.4.5 lakh.
Number of seats: The intake of the Programs are as under
- B.Tech (Information and Communication Technology (ICT) – 240
- B.Tech (Honours in ICT with minor in Computational Science) - 60
Gujarat Category: 50% of seats are reserved for candidates who have passed the Qualifying Examination from the schools located in the State of Gujarat. These seats are to be filled in through the Admission Committee for Professional Courses (ACPC), Gujarat.
All India Category: The remaining fifty percent will be filled in directly by DA-IICT.
All India Category candidates belonging to Scheduled Caste and Scheduled Tribe will be admitted on relaxed criteria as compared to the general category candidates. In case some of the reserved seats are not filled in, the unfilled seats will be transferred to the general category. For Gujarat Category, ACPC will follow its own policy in this regard.
